An application under section 37 of the Planning Act 2008(1) (the “2008 Act”) has been made to the Secretary of State for an order granting development consent.

The application has been examined by a single appointed person who has made a report to the Secretary of State under section 83(1) of the 2008 Act. After receiving the report, the Secretary of State requested further information from various persons.

The Secretary of State has considered the report and recommendation of the single appointed person, has taken into consideration the environmental information in accordance with regulation 3 of the Infrastructure Planning (Environmental Impact Assessment) Regulations 2009(2) and has had regard to the documents and matters referred to in section 104(2) of the 2008 Act.

The Secretary of State, having decided the application, has determined to make an order giving effect to the proposals comprised in the application on terms that in the opinion of the Secretary of State are not materially different from those proposed in the application.

Accordingly, the Secretary of State, in exercise of the powers in sections 114 and 120 of the 2008 Act, makes the following Order—
